At its core, choosing the right first automatic car means understanding how automation supports real-life demands. Automatic transmissions eliminate manual gear shifts, letting drivers focus on the road or manage workflows while driving—critical for busy professionals, parents, and anyone seeking mental ease during commutes. Modern automatics combine predictive shift systems with responsive acceleration, reducing driver effort even in stop-and-go traffic.

What fuel economy or efficiency should I expect?
Safety ratings consistently highlight integrated driver assistance systems that are almost always standard in today’s automatics. Features like automatic braking, blind-spot monitoring, and adaptive cruise control reduce reaction time and error—making automatics not just easier to drive, but safer across urban and highway environments.

Automatic cars deliver inherent simplicity—no shifting, no dual clutch coordination. Most models feature intuitive paddle shifters or shift-by-wire systems that reduce hand movement, making lane transitions smoother. Vehicle design prioritizes ergonomic feedback and clear drivability indicators, supporting confidence even for new drivers or those transitioning from manual anticipation.
